WASHINGTON: The wait is finally about to end as Apple is all set to unveil its flagship smartphone Apple iPhone 6s on September 9.

In the event we are expected to see the iPhone 6S and iPhone 6S Plus unveiled while there are also rumours are circulating that a budget iPhone could debut at the event as well.

The actual launch event will be larger than usual with San Francisco’s Bill Graham Civic Auditorium, which can hold up to 7,000 people, named as the location instead of the smaller Flint Center in Cupertino, where Apple’s media event was held last year.

While the final build of iOS 9 is set to launch with the iPhone 6S and iPhone 6S Plus, we’re also expecting to see the new Force Touch tech find its way to Apple’s phones.

Aside from the two handsets, Apple may also give us a look at Apple Watch OS 2, OS X El Capitan and perhaps even the new iPad Pro and Apple TV 2.
